Provenance — Plowmark Telemetry Gateway. Every shipped gateway image is built by the Harrowline pipeline from a tagged commit; no manual builds are supported. Support: when a customer reports firmware oddities, confirm the image came from the pipeline before debugging. Unsigned images are field modifications and out of scope. To verify, compare the unit's report against the build token below.

build token for kagaf-hahof: htk14_9d3d4d26d7d8de

## Franchise Agreement — Sales Leads Briefing (Managers Only)

Good news: the Tindermill Coffee franchise deal with the Valebrook group is basically signed. They'll open three sites in the Corris Valley region over the next year. For sales leads, this means warm intros to their procurement folks and a co-branded launch push. Hold off on customer-facing chatter until the announcement drops. The confidential plan behind the deal is below.

management briefing: The renewal with Quenathox Group closes at $10 million a year, 20 percent below the last contract. Project Ulawyn slips by two quarters because of the supplier delay.

Handover note — Crumbwheel order cutoffs.

Welcome aboard. The bakery cutoff rule in Crumbwheel closes same-day orders at 14:00 local to each storefront, not UTC — this has bitten us twice. Holiday overrides live in the calendar service and take precedence silently, so always check there first when a cutoff looks wrong. To unlock the calendar service's admin console after a restart, enter the recovery passphrase below.

vault phrase of bagap-bahaf = silion-pelox-sorox-casdor-quenwyn-fraax-eliox-praael-kelion-quenvan-kasox-rusael-norius-belvan

This page covers break-glass access to the quota service for Hatchgrove's plugin platform. Per-tenant rate quotas are enforced centrally; plugin authors cannot raise them through the normal API. If a critical plugin is hard-throttled during an incident, the emergency override console can lift a tenant's quota for one hour. All overrides are logged and reviewed. The console requires the break-glass recovery passphrase, which the platform team keeps updated on the line directly beneath this section.

vault phrase of bawig-tawef = briix-ralath